Add Storybook preview deploy + changed-stories comment on PRs (#6929)

## What

Adds a **Storybook preview** for PRs. When a PR changes any story
(`*.stories.{ts,tsx,mdx}`) or the `.storybook` config, this builds the
static Storybook, deploys it to the preview VPS on a PR-scoped port, and
comments with the URL plus an **expandable list of exactly which stories
changed**. Torn down automatically when the PR closes.

New file: `.github/workflows/storybook-preview.yml`. Nothing else is
touched.

## How

- **Detect** (`changes` job) - `dorny/paths-filter` with `list-files:
json` flags Storybook changes and captures the exact changed files.
Skipped on close and for fork PRs (which don't get the VPS secrets).
- **Deploy** (`deploy` job, only when Storybook changed) - builds the
static Storybook (`task frontend:prepare` + `frontend:storybook:build`),
tars it, and serves it from an `nginx:alpine` container on the VPS at
port `PR# + 20000` (offset from the app preview's bare-PR-number port to
avoid collisions). Mirrors `PR-Auto-Deploy-V2.yml`'s VPS SSH pattern and
reuses the same secrets.
- **Comment** - a single bot comment (replaced on each push) with the
preview URL and a `<details>` block listing the changed stories (and any
`.storybook` config changes), e.g.:

  > ## 📚 Storybook preview
  > 🔗 **Preview:** http://&lt;vps&gt;:26911
> <details><summary>2 stories changed (+1 config
file)</summary>…</details>

- **Cleanup** (`cleanup` job, on PR close) - stops the container,
removes the files, and deletes the comment.

## Validation

- Static Storybook builds locally (`task frontend:storybook:build` →
`frontend/storybook-static`, 151 stories).
- Confirmed `task frontend:prepare` regenerates the un-committed
`material-symbols-icons.json` that stories import, so a fresh CI
checkout builds (added it before the build step).
- Comment-markdown logic unit-checked against a sample changed-files
list.
- YAML validated; action pins match the repo (`setup-node` v6.4.0 / node
22, same `paths-filter`, `setup-bot`, `harden-runner`).

## Note

The VPS deploy mirrors the proven `PR-Auto-Deploy-V2` machinery but
couldn't be exercised end-to-end from a dev box (needs the VPS secrets)
- the first live run on a Storybook-touching PR will confirm the
deploy/serve/cleanup path. Everything build- and comment-side is
validated locally.
